My story

Here's what the humans have to say about me:

All this guy wants is a person to call his own. Scooter was returned to ARF through no fault of his own, and is having a more difficult time adjusting back to shelter life. Once Scooter gets to know someone new, he is extremely loving and affectionate. He takes his time getting to know new people, as new places and faces can be quite frightening to this boy. If you have patience, a quiet home with not many visitors or other pets, consider giving Scooter a chance. He is sure to repay your efforts with a lifetime of love!

More about this shelter

The Animal Rescue Fund of the Hamptons actively rescues cats and dogs, provides quality care and offers sanctuary until loving homes can be found.
ARF’s work with animals, within our community and throughout the organization is guided by three core values: compassion, integrity and dedication.
